Man dies in crash in eastern Colorado

PROWERS COUNTY, COLO. -- Colorado State troopers said a Florida man died in eastern Colorado Tuesday afternoon when he overcorrected after drifting off the highway.

According to troopers, 29-year-old Lance Brooks from Key West, Fla. overcorrected his 2006 Chevrolet pickup truck after drifting off the right side of Highway 385 near mile marker 102 in Prowers County around 4:50 p.m. Tuesday. The truck then swerved left, rotated, went off the left side of the road and rolled twice.

Brooks was not wearing a seatbelt and was thrown from the truck. He was taken to Prowers Medical Center, where he died.

Troopers are still investigating the cause of the crash but said it doesn't appear Brooks had alcohol or drugs in his system at the time.

Mile marker 102 is about three miles north of Bristol.
